Aplicativo de documento pesquisável on-line e código da biblioteca de pesquisa de texto PDF

Desenvolva um poderoso software ou utilitário de mecanismo de pesquisa de documentos PDF baseado em C++. Teste o aplicativo localizador de texto de documentos online gratuitamente.

Aplicativo online gratuito de pesquisa de conteúdo de documentos PDF

Como pesquisar em arquivo PDF online usando o aplicativo

  1. Carregue o arquivo PDF para pesquisar clicando dentro da área para soltar ou arrastando e soltando.
  2. Insira os critérios de pesquisa especificando os parâmetros.
  3. Clique no botão “PESQUISAR” para pesquisar PDF.
  4. Baixe o PDF pesquisado para visualizar instantaneamente.

Como pesquisar arquivo PDF via C++

  1. Instale ‘Aspose.PDF para C++’.
  2. Adicione uma referência de biblioteca (importe a biblioteca) ao seu projeto C++.
  3. Abra o arquivo PDF de origem usando a classe Document.
  4. Crie TextFragmentAbsorber para encontrar todas as instâncias da entrada.
  5. Escolha o absorvedor para as páginas usando get_Pages()->Accept.
  6. Obtenha os fragmentos de texto extraídos usando get_TextFragments.
  7. Faça um loop pelos fragmentos para obter a saída.
  8. Chame o método Save para salvar o documento atualizado.
 

Exemplo de código em C++ para pesquisar texto em arquivos PDF

 
 

Desenvolva mecanismo de pesquisa de arquivos PDF via C++

Precisa desenvolver um software ou utilitário pesquisável PDF? Com Aspose.PDF para C++, uma API filha do Aspose.Total para C++, qualquer desenvolvedor C++ pode integrar o código C++ da biblioteca acima para programar a pesquisa de texto em documentos. A poderosa biblioteca C++ permite programar uma solução de software de pesquisa de documentos que pode suportar muitos formatos populares, incluindo o formato PDF.

Biblioteca C++ para pesquisar arquivo PDF

Existem opções para instalar “Aspose.PDF for C++” ou “Aspose.Total for C++” em seu sistema. Escolha um que se adeque às suas necessidades e siga as instruções passo a passo:

Requisitos de sistema

Você pode usar esta biblioteca C++ para desenvolver software nos sistemas operacionais Microsoft Windows, Linux e macOS:

  • Sistemas operacionais de 32 bits.
  • Área de trabalho do Microsoft Windows (7, 8, 10)
  • Versões antigas do sistema operacional (XP, Vista e Server 2003)
  • Microsoft Visual Studio 2017 ou posterior.



Se você desenvolve software para Linux ou macOS, verifique as informações sobre dependências adicionais da biblioteca no Product Documentation .

FAQs

  • Posso usar o código C++ acima em meu aplicativo?
    Sim, você tem permissão para baixar ou copiar este código com a finalidade de desenvolver aplicativos baseados em C++ focados na extração e recuperação de texto de vários tipos de arquivos.
  • Este aplicativo pesquisável de documento funciona apenas no Windows?
    Você pode realizar pesquisas a partir de qualquer dispositivo, independente do sistema operacional (Windows, Linux, Mac OS ou Android), desde que esteja equipado com um navegador moderno e uma conexão ativa à Internet.
  • É seguro usar o aplicativo online PDF Document Search?
    Claro! Os arquivos de saída serão excluídos automaticamente de nossos servidores dentro de 24 horas e os links de download associados ficarão inativos.
  • Qual navegador deve usar o aplicativo?
    Você pode utilizar navegadores contemporâneos como Google Chrome, Firefox, Opera ou Safari para pesquisas online de documentos PDF. No entanto, ao criar um aplicativo de desktop, recomendamos o uso da API Aspose.Total Document Search para um processamento eficiente e contínuo.

Explorar Pesquisa de arquivos Opções com C++

Procure em DOC (Formato binário do Microsoft Word)
Procure em DOCX (Documento do Word do Office 2007+)
Procure em EXCEL (Formatos de arquivo de planilha)
Procure em ODP (Formato de Apresentação OpenDocument)
Procure em ODS (Planilha OpenDocument)
Procure em ODT (Formato de Arquivo de Texto OpenDocument)
Procure em PDF (Formato de Documento Portátil)
Procure em POWERPOINT (Arquivos de apresentação)
Procure em PPT (Apresentação em powerpoint)
Procure em PPTX (Formato de apresentação XML aberto)
Procure em WORD (Formatos de arquivo de processamento de texto)
Procure em XLS (Formato binário do Microsoft Excel)
Procure em XLSX (Abra a pasta de trabalho XML)